Background
The Father's Vice - Leto's father, Remus mal Diomedes was never accused of being a gracious or forgiving man. Leto's rebellious, stubborn nature was met with a strong hand and a structure of control. His father's disappointment in the boy was always clear, never seeing the boy strive for his true potential. He squeezed through his schooling and training as an officer only thanks to his father's name and his own whit, not from intelligence or hard study. Often relegated to attending his father's events as a form of entertainment, playing music from a silent corner of the room while the heads of state and military wings conversed. He leapt at the first chance to escape his father's rule.
Clipped Wings - Leto's athleticism and sensory acuity made him an excellent candidate for aeronautical application. He applied himself to the practice unlike any of his peers, making up for intellectual study with dedication and pure talent to the craft. He would have very likely earned himself a command in the prestigious aeronautical unit beneath the VI th legion, along side the Agrius... but his dreams were squashed when he drew the ire of one of his instructors, who took the opportunity to deny the young man. Leto earned himself a commission as an airship pilot serving with the XII th legion in Doma, transporting field engineers throughout the region, supporting the fleet. Over twenty years of service in the territory earned him an upstanding command of his own vessel and crew.
His reward was short lived however, when he placed his ship and crew in harms way to save a company of civilians. His selfless act brought his ship down in a fiery ball of ceruleum, earning him the respect of the local population and the anger of the occupying officers. Unable to punish the now local hero for fear of upsetting the population, they saw fit to remove him from his command and "promote" him to a new position.
Patent Pending - Leto's new command was beneath no other than his father Remus. His "promotion" was an obvious slight to him and his family and put the man back beneath the stringent tutelage of his totalitarian father. Leto was put to task running a small team of magitek engineers, designing compact power sources for individual magitek devices. The cumbersome nature of ceruleum tanks makes application for smaller units of magitek difficult, so his team underwent experiments of a rare auricite and the construction of his own patent design for aether-nets to trap and charge the new cells with local aether.
An investigation into his father's research would derail his goals when he discovered project MERCY. His father's design would upend the world, placing conquered territories under full control by removing the freedom of will. Leto sought to destroy his father's work, but there was more to it than files and stacks of research. His father's design was implanted in the flesh of an innocent Doman conscript, Linyu aan Lutum. Leto elected to destroy his fathers lab and run from the capital with Linyu in tow on a stolen airship prototype and bounty on his head.

Background
From Clay - Linyu is a product of the Garlean propaganda machine. Taken from her Doman village at the age of seven as insurance for her family's cooperation with their Garlean occupiers, Linyu was raised in one of Garlemald's cultural integration programs for foreign workers, and given the surname "Lutum", which means clay. And indeed, her upbringing did mold her as intended: With very little memory of her home or family, Linyu worked very hard to make herself of use to the empire and rise above the menial tasks to which most non-citizens were assigned. Proving herself highly intelligent and agreeable, Linyu was accepted to study medical science at the Imperial Academy for Foreign Assimilation, and graduated top of her class... not that this afforded her much distinction. She then received her first assignment, working as an assistant medicus in a research lab under the direction of Remus mal Diomedes.
Small Mercies - In her new position, Linyu began to struggle. The laboratory to which she was assigned was engaged in refining advanced applications of hypertuning, the combining of man and magitek that emerged as a side-endeavor from the Resonant Project. These experiments had a very high mortality for the subjects involved, all foreign non-citizens like Linyu. Her duties centered around tending to their medical needs, and the emotional toll was quite brutal. Linyu quickly went from a bright, ambitious Garlean subject hoping to earn citizenship to heartsore, and a little bit rebellious. Linyu very quietly defied orders, euthanizing a few of the suffering test subjects without authorization, her own little acts of mercy. Upon being caught, Remus mal Diomedes decided that instead of reporting her insubordination, she would be of more use as a subject for a secret project he was running. He declared this decision to be truly merciful, and so named the experiment Project MERCY.
Subject Alpha - The project into which Linyu was forcibly recruited had the goal of increasing Garlean control over hypertuned conscripts, and perhaps over entire populations of foreigners in the territories the empire occupied. Magitek implants were placed into her brain to suppress unwanted emotional states, such as anger, fear, and suspicion, and promote obedience to those above her in the social order. These implants were flawed prototypes, however, and damaged adjacent parts of her brain, leaving Linyu partially paralyzed and in critical condition. Eager to save Project Mercy, which had cost too much to make a fresh start feasible, Remus mal Diomedes outfitted Linyu with some of the technology being used in his more mainstream hypertuning experiments, and then applauded himself for saving her life. Linyu was no longer capable of resenting him for it, though she understood how nefarious his actions were in an objective sense.
Trapped in a laboratory, Linyu might have lingered indefinitely under the Praefectus' thumb, had his son Leto not broken into the laboratory one night to destroy his father's work. Luckily for Linyu, he valued her life enough to take her with him when he escaped. They fled to Ishgard, in hopes that the experts at the Skysteel Manufactory could assist in understanding what had been done to her, and perhaps reverse it.
